A continuación encontrarás traducido al Castellano el artículo escrito por Paul Lefebvre y publicado originalmente en el Blog oficial de Xojo.
Los proyectos Android creados con Xojo ofrecen un soporte robusto para el uso de Declare y Librerías, y que puedes utilizar para realizar llamadas a muchas de las librerías y frameworks nativos de Android. Ahora con el recién añadido AndroidMobileUserControl también puedes crear tus propios controles de Interfaz de Usuario.
Este control está disponible en el panel Library de Xojo y funciona de forma similar a cómo lo hace iOSMobileUserControl en los proyectos de Xojo para dispositivos iOS: arrástralo sobre el diseño e implementa el evento CreateView.
Declare Function Button Lib "Kotlin" Alias "android.widget.Button(context as android.content.Context)" (context As Ptr) As Ptr Var bp As Ptr = Button(App.AndroidContextHandle) Return bp
El anterior fragmento de código utiliza un Declare para crear un Botón nativo y lo devuelve de modo que pueda ser mostrado en el diseño.
Mediante el uso de AndroidMobileUserControl y los Declare para acceder a la librería Android UI, puedes crear tus propios controles de Interfaz de Usuario. ¡Estamos deseando ver los creados por la comunidad!